The Midnight Snack Theory of Energy Management

Imagine your building's storage system as a giant cookie jar for electricity. When rates drop during off-peak hours (hello 2 AM!), it secretly stockpiles cheap power. Then when everyone's running AC units at noon, it serves up stored energy like a considerate roommate sharing snacks. This isn't just theory - the Mirage Towers in San Diego slashed their energy bills by 30% using this exact strategy.

Breaking Down the Tech Buffet

Today's apartment energy solutions offer more flavors than a Brooklyn ice cream shop:

  • Lithium-ion batteries (the Tesla of the bunch)
  • Thermal storage using phase-change materials
  • Second-generation flow batteries
  • Hybrid systems combining solar + storage

Installation Realities: No Hard Hat Required

Contrary to popular belief, retrofitting old apartments isn't like performing heart surgery with a spoon. Modern modular systems can be installed in phases:

  1. Energy audit (the building's "check-up")
  2. Load profile analysis (finding energy vampires)
  3. System sizing (Goldilocks-style "just right" planning)
  4. Phased implementation (no need to empty the pool)

The Regulatory Maze Made Simple

Navigating energy policies can feel like deciphering IKEA instructions, but recent changes are game-changers:

  • Updated FERC rules allowing aggregated storage participation
  • 30% federal tax credits through 2032
  • Local incentives like NYC's Property Assessed Clean Energy program

AI: The Building's New Super

Modern management systems are getting smarter than a MIT grad student. Machine learning algorithms now predict energy needs based on factors like:

  • Weather patterns
  • Tenant behavior (Netflix binge nights vs. weekend getaways)
  • Local event schedules (stadium concerts = power surges)
